參考 springboot 統一json返回格式 代碼 自定義響應類 測試 ...
Spring Boot返回數據及異常統一封裝 企業實戰之spring項目 接口響應體格式統一封裝 Spring Boot fastjson替換jackson java web項目發布到tomcat時配置不打包jar的方案 使用Hibernate Validator優雅的驗證RESTful Web Services的參數 自定義注解實現入參指定枚舉值校驗 Running Setup Data on ...
2019-03-12 10:39 0 696 推薦指數:
參考 springboot 統一json返回格式 代碼 自定義響應類 測試 ...
為什么還要寫這類文章?因為我看過網上很多講解的都不夠全面,而本文結合實際工作講解了swaggerui文檔,統一響應格式,異常處理,權限驗證等常用模塊,並提供一套完善的案例源代碼,在實際工作中可直接參考使用。 一、先看看最終效果 這是最后生成的swagerui文檔,大家可以直接訪問這個地址體驗 ...
在最流行的前后端交互的項目中,后端一般都是返回指定格式的數據供前端解析,本文使用注解方式返回統一格式的數據,那么下面就看看是如何使用的吧 1)返回響應碼實體 2)返回數據實體 若上述靜態方法還不滿足,可自定義添加。 3)定義注解 此注解用在類 ...
1.@RestControllerAdvice,RestController的增強類,可用於實現全局異常處理器 2.@ExceptionHandler,統一處理某一類異常,從而減少代碼重復率和復雜度,比如要獲取自定義異常可以@ExceptionHandler ...
SpringBoot統一返回格式及參數校驗 說明:以下內容摘抄自以下博文: https://www.cnblogs.com/jianzh5/p/15018838.html https://www.cnblogs.com/jianzh5/p/15131121.html ...
傳統實現 在搭建 Web API 服務的時候,針對客戶端請求,我們一般都會自定義響應的 JSON 格式,比如: 在基於 ASP.NET Web API 的應用程序,我們一般會創建一個相應結構的 C# 類,如下: 這里約定, ErrorMessage 為空或null,即表示沒有異 ...
ServerResponse(服務器統一響應數據格式) 前言: 其實嚴格來說,ServerResponse應該歸類到common包中。但是我實在太喜歡這玩意兒了。而且用得也非常頻繁,所以忍不住推薦一下。 借此機會,申明一點,這個系列的類並不是都是我原創的,都是我從各個項目中看到的,感覺非常贊 ...
主要字段: status(int) ------接口調用狀態碼 msg(String) ------接口需要響應的信息 data(T) ------接口相應的泛型數據對象 ...